Résumé

The PHP language and PostgreSQL database server have long offered an ideal blend of practicality and power for both the novice and experienced programmer alike. Yet the continued evolution of both technologies makes them better suited to drive enterprise-class applications than ever before. In this book, noted authors Cristian Darie and Mihai Bucica show you how to take advantage of this powerful duo to build an e-commerce web site, guiding you step-by-step through the process of developing and deploying the project.

Each chapter is devoted to a specific new feature. You'll learn how to build an online product catalog complete with a shopping cart, checkout mechanism, product search feature, product recommendations, administrative features, customer accounts, an order-management system, and more. You'll also learn how to process electronic payments by integrating several popular payment services, including PayPal, DataCash, and VeriSign Payflow Pro.

  • This is the first book that shows you how to construct a complete e-commerce site from scratch.
  • Takes advantage of PHP and PostgreSQL-two of the most popular open source technologies in the world-to build a high-powered e-commerce web site.
  • Shows you how to expand your product selection and revenue streams by using Web Services to integrate Amazon's offerings into your site.
